So from this year onwards Fabio Aru will work under the direction of Mattia Michelusi, Venetian born in 1985 (at the beginning of the photo @1_in_the_gutter), graduated in Sports Science with a specialization in Sports Science and Technique. A past as a rider, hence the studies, the passage to the Federal Study Centre as trainer of sports directors, the arrival to professionalism with Androni Giocattoli and then to the WorldTour, first with Ef Cannondale and now with the Team Qhubeka Assos. However, net of the securities in his possession, When a coach starts working with an athlete, books are certainly not the first source he draws from.

I knew Aru as an athlete, but I didn't know Fabio as a person.Technology helps us plan distance training sessions and know what effects they have on the rider, but the fundamental aspect of the retreat in Spain was precisely that of getting to know himWe had planned one at altitude in January, but he preferred cross-country, so we adjusted our preparation. I am in favor of this discipline, it can be useful for any athlete, even for the climber. It offers stimuli that however need to be integrated with preparation for the roadObviously his goal wasn't to become world champion, but to train and do it in a stress-free environment.

So you redesigned your preparation based on the work done in cross-country?

By placing these training stimuli in a broad context, for example, consisting of longer sessions. Knowing yourself also leads to analyzing what you've experienced, because you learn from both the good and the bad moments. The feeling is that the first Aru trained on climbs to win, but now the climb is a difficulty to be faced and overcome. For this reason We also analyzed how he worked at the beginning and what he has done in the last two years.

It is therefore wrong to think that with Michelusi we can or should start from scratch.

Fabio is an experienced athlete, it would be wrong to think of making a clean sweepBut we need to work alongside him to understand how he responds to certain stimuli. We can have all the data in the world, but to understand how he reacts to workloads, for example, there's nothing better than looking at his faceIf he reaches the top of a climb exhausted, it means the effort was excessive. If he arrives smiling, then more can be done. Obviously, gradually. We're not at the top of the season yet. We will certainly increase it further because we will be able to better evaluate your answers.

Have you introduced any new elements into your work plan so far?

No, nothing. We simply integrated the cross. Even if it was interrupted, we continue to make concentrated efforts that it would be pointless to abandon completelyFabio believed in this path and it was right to pursue it, foreseeing a few more hints of the same intensity.

How do you see it?

I see him as really very motivated.
